Understanding What a Fire Sprinkler Examination In Fact Covers
A specialist fire sprinkler test in Seattle reviews numerous crucial components at once. Inspectors assess water pressure to validate the system can provide adequate circulation during an emergency situation. They inspect sprinkler heads for physical damage, deterioration, paint overspray, or any type of obstruction that would certainly avoid correct activation.
Beyond the equipment, testers also evaluate control valves to make sure they remain in the completely open position and protected correctly. Any kind of valve discovered partially closed can seriously minimize the effectiveness of the system during a fire. Alarm system connections likewise come under testimonial, because a lawn sprinkler that triggers however stops working to cause an alarm can delay emergency feedback.
In older Seattle buildings, examiners usually pay very close attention to pipe problems, specifically in properties where galvanized steel piping is still in place. Galvanized pipes are prone to interior corrosion build-up that limits water flow over time. Determining this problem very early enables property owners to plan for repiping before a total failure occurs.
How Typically Should You Check Your System?
The regularity of screening depends upon the kind of building and the age of the system. For the majority of household and business buildings in Seattle, a full inspection at the very least annually is the market standard. Quarterly aesthetic checks by the property owner or structure supervisor are additionally a good idea, particularly in the months following any kind of remarkable seismic activity in the area.
After any quake determining 3.0 or higher on the Richter scale, scheduling an immediate specialist inspection is an audio choice. Even if no visible damage appears, underground pipe links or concealed installations inside walls may have shifted sufficient to compromise the system's dependability. Waiting till the next yearly cycle to examine after a seismic event presents unnecessary threat.

What Makes the very best Equipments Stand Out
When the time concerns upgrade or install a new system, comprehending what separates a common arrangement from the best fire sprinklers in Seattle helps you make a more informed financial investment. High-performance systems made for seismically energetic zones incorporate flexible combinings and seismic bracing that enables the piping to absorb activity without fracturing. These parts are not constantly common in off-the-shelf setups, but they deserve specifying explicitly when dealing with your specialist.
Corrosion-resistant materials make a considerable difference in Seattle's environment. Copper and CPVC piping normally exceed galvanized steel in damp, damp environments, lowering the probability of internal accumulation that restricts water flow. Sprinkler heads with faster activation temperature levels may likewise be appropriate for sure occupancies, making certain a quicker reaction in areas where heat might build quickly.
Smart monitoring innovation has actually become progressively obtainable for both domestic and commercial systems. Wireless flow sensing units, remote valve tracking, and real-time signals tied to your mobile phone provide you presence right into system status without waiting for the annual examination. In a city where a shake can strike without warning, that kind of continuous understanding has genuine worth.
Practical Tips Every Seattle Homeowner Need To Take
Beginning by situating all shut-off shutoffs in your structure and validating they are plainly identified and obtainable. An automatic sprinkler that performs flawlessly in screening gives little defense if emergency situation workers can not swiftly reach the main shut-off throughout a fire feedback.
Maintain a written assessment log for your system. Paperwork of past examinations, any type of deficiencies kept in mind, and rehabilitative activities taken creates a proof that offers you in insurance cases, home sales, and compliance audits. Digital documents stored in the cloud include an additional layer of protection versus loss during a calamity.
Make it a routine to visually check visible sprinkler heads every couple of months. Search for heads that show up corroded, repainted over, or physically bent. Keep in mind any heads situated near heat resources like light fixtures or cooling and heating vents, as these can trigger too soon or deteriorate faster than others. Record any worries to a licensed fire security specialist rather than attempting repair services on your own.
